Description
Benzo[C]Cinnoline is a nitrogen-containing heterocyclic compound belonging to the cinnoline family, characterized by its fused aromatic ring structure. This specialty chemical serves as a valuable intermediate and building block in advanced organic synthesis and materials science research. It is primarily utilized by R&D chemists and process engineers in the pharmaceutical, agrochemical, and organic electronics sectors for developing novel compounds and functional materials.

Basic Information
| Product Name | Benzo[C]Cinnoline |
| CAS No. | 230-17-1 |
| Molecular Formula | C12H8N2 |
| Molecular Weight | 180.21 g/mol |
| Synonyms | Benzo[c]cinnoline; Dibenzopyridazine; 2,3-Diazafluorene; 1,2-Diazafluorene; NSC 6175; Benzo[c]cinnoline; 1,2-Diazaphenanthrene |
| EINECS | 205-941-9 |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C). Keep away from heat, sparks, and open flames. Due to its light-sensitive nature, handling and packaging should minimize exposure to direct light.
